逃不过的双11「算法围城」,需要时间同步!
时间:2022-11-10 阅读:377
商品的活动优惠券、直播预览、当天的新闻热搜……当你的手机不断跳出这些你感兴趣的推送弹窗,无论你在现实生活中是什么身份,拿起手机的那一刻你就很难不受到算法的影响。
你会发现,只要自己随手点开了某个电商平台上的推荐商品,或者只是在其他社交平台上搜索了相关词,各个平台就会密集地出现这一类商品的信息,
那么,推荐算法是如何一步步“圈养”用户,做到信息同步,实现“个性推荐”的呢?
l 推荐算法:用技术应对信息爆炸
倒推来看,个性推荐——算法——数据标签——数据中心,这是一个基础的推荐逻辑。简单来说,就是在数据中心中创建无数个标签符号,每个标签根据算法匹配到每个单位个体,再根据标签完成单位个体的一次个性推荐。
推荐算法最初走进公众视野是始于字节跳动的主力产品今日头条。《财经天下》报道,今日头条于2012年8月上线,作为国内以机器推荐为主要分发方式的新闻资讯App,今日头条上线仅90天,便横扫1000万用户,并在国内带火了“推荐算法”这一概念。
此后,从资讯平台到短视频平台,越来越多的互联网公司看见了“推荐算法”的力量。而以淘宝为首的电商平台,更是一步步依赖起推荐算法。早在2013 年,淘宝就推出了排名算法——“千人千面”,依托淘宝的数据库,从细分类目中抓取特征与用户兴趣点匹配的推广商品。
在当今5G/6G时代,互联网作为一种“高维媒介”,充分激活了用户个人的信息生产能力,也带来了庞大冗杂的信息爆炸。算法推荐作为信息与受众之间的技术中介,对庞大的信息进行挖掘并将其与用户个人需求匹配,通过技术的快速分发,解决了信息爆炸时代的信息分发方式和渠道问题,从而实现信息分发的“减法思维”。
l 时间同步:赋能「算法」背后的数据王国
但是,要想使推荐算法得到更好的的执行,就需要各个环节和设备之间的精准传输协同工作。时间同步产品的功能就是在各个环节和设备的工作中为其起到提供标准时间信号、降低乃至消除延时,保障信息传输和安全的作用。如果没有时间同步产品,那么整个推荐算法的精准性和及时性就会大打折扣,最终导致“个性推荐”功能无法正常运行。
为了更好的实现算法推荐,现在主流云服务领域一般会采用分布式数据中心的架构。分布式部署的数据中心,对多中心时间同步的要求也更高。
数据中心进化历程
因为在分布式的存储和运算当中,会存在大量节点设备。而大部分电子设备(服务器、工作站、交换机等)都有自己的本地时钟振荡器,用来保证设备内运算和处理频率一致,但又无法保证相位一致(时间同步)。
而时间不一致则会导致获取外部节点的数据和状态错误,从而引发错误响应。以精度为50ppm(5×10-5)的时钟振荡器为例,理论上自走1天可偏差4.32秒(5×10-5 ×60×60×24=4.32)。
因此,为了避免服务器等设备自身运行的偏差,有必要通过统一的时间源进行时间同步。
时间同步在算法读写中的作用
为了使每一次推荐算法都精准送达受众,分布式数据中心需要精确同步,以时间戳来确定事件、操作的先后顺序。
具体可以为其背后的每个分布式中心建设一套时钟系统,将数据中心之间的时间同步精确到1us以内,精度提升100倍,完成区域同步。
这种架构方式可以支持冗余配置。其工作逻辑就是时间服务器通过卫星接收获得UTC基准时间(50-100ns量级);然后再选配铯原子钟,提供地面保持能力,预防因卫星故障而导致时间偏差的意外情况;最后通过IEEE1588信号提供区域高精度同步,网内同步精度可以达到100-500ns量级。
分布式数据中心时间同步解决方案架构
l 赛思时频同步:助力各个系统「算法」实现精准分发
赛思作为一家专注于研制各类时钟芯片、时间频率同步设备、提供各行业时频同步解决方案的时频科技企业。在云数据服务领域有着成熟的应用经验,是国内头部云服务商阿里云、腾讯云等的长期战略合作伙伴。
同时,赛思也是国内少数可以提供完整端到端解决方案的时频研发设计公司,拥有目前国内时频领域全产品系列线。具备时频大型组网和管理能力,主要产品包括高精度时钟芯片、晶振、各类NTP/PTP时间服务器、子母钟系统、北斗共视设备、卫星智能分路系统、时空安全隔离装置、授时板卡/模块、时统系统、测试平台及软件等,产品组合应用可以为社会各行各业的各个系统算法的精准运行起到保障传输、降低延时与通信加密的护航作用。
赛思时钟芯片产品
产品及解决方案实现全行业覆盖,包括元宇宙、VR/AR、人工智能、区块链、5G通信、量子通信、工业物联网、北斗卫星导航、电力能源、金融证券、航空航天、科研院校、生物医疗、云数据中心、汽车自动驾驶等领域。
时频智造产业将随着社会智能化程度的加深而不断延伸,扩展服务与应用边界。未来的数字社会,将会是一个高度同频的精准世界。赛思期待与更多人共创精准,智造未来!